### Step 2: Align your plugin with the post-incident cache settings

Following the stale-cache postmortem, QuillCache core now enforces shorter TTLs and mandatory revalidation. Plugins that set their own cache headers will be overridden. Remove any local TTL logic before upgrading to SDK 3.0; otherwise the host rejects registration at startup. Test against the staging host, not prod. The host now enforces the following configuration values:

deployment values, bajop-yahaf:
[holax]
host = holax.tolvaqsys.corp
user = holax_svc
database = holax_prod

## Local Setup — Health Checks

The Quillgate service sits behind the Marrowby load balancer. Health checks hit `/healthz` every 5s; three failures eject the node. Locally, run `make lb-sim` to mimic this. The health endpoint verifies database liveness with a cheap `SELECT 1`, so the check fails if the DB is unreachable. Point your local instance at the database using the string below.

replica DSN, kajep-yahag: mssql://praok_svc:iF@db-8d68.plorvaio.local:5432/eliion

Changed defaults in Splitfork, our assignment service. Bucketing now uses sticky hashing per account instead of per session, and the holdout slice grew from 2% to 5%. Callers relying on session-level reassignment must opt in explicitly. Review the diff against the new baseline; the updated default configuration is listed below.

config for tagep-kajof:
[casir]
port = 6379
region = south-1
host = casir.paliqdyn.example
team = tamax
timeout_ms = 250
retries = 2